THE BUILDING
When designing or refurnishing a ward such as an Intensive Care Unit in a hospital, the project presents itself from the outset as a highly complex challenge in both technical and managerial terms.
The contract usually involves the integrated installation of mechanical and electrical systems, as well as the complete refurbishment of the ward.

THE PROJECT
Given these challenges, projects are always a joint effort between those who design the systems and those who install them, with the aim of developing an advanced solution for the control and monitoring of the entire department.
One of the most recent projects undertaken, within a hospital, involved:
• systems for generating hot and cold fluids using multi-purpose heat pumps
• air handling units dedicated to the primary air supply
• precise control of temperature, humidity and air quality for each individual patient room
• full integration between mechanical and electrical systems
The key feature was the introduction of an advanced environmental pressure management system.
Thanks to an architecture based on BACnet communication and a control structure incorporating advanced logic, it was possible to develop a system capable of:
• manage rooms under positive pressure (typical of sterile areas)
• manage negative-pressure rooms (required for
infectious patients)
• switch dynamically between one mode and another
This is a significant innovation, particularly in a post-pandemic context, where the operational flexibility of healthcare spaces has become a strategic requirement.
THE METHOD
Use of CosterCAD and WebGarage.
• A key role in this project was played not only by the ability to develop complex logic, thanks to CosterCAD, but also by the WebGarage platform, which was used as a remote monitoring, control and management system.
WebGarage made it possible to:
• monitor all environmental parameters in the department in real time
• manage systems and settings remotely without the need for immediate on-site intervention
• respond quickly to anomalies (temperature, humidity, pressure)
• provide an intuitive and user-friendly interface, even for non-technical operators
From an operational perspective, this means that, when a report is received – for example, from users – it is possible to:
identify the problem, analyse it and take immediate action remotely, thereby reducing the time and complexity of the intervention.
WebGarage therefore becomes not just a technical tool, but a guarantee of operational continuity.
THE ADVANTAGES
Benefits for the end customer.
The final outcome of the project translates into a range of concrete, measurable and strategic benefits for the healthcare facility.
Safety and quality for patients.
Precise control of temperature, humidity, air quality and pressure ensures safe and compliant environments, even in the most critical situations.
Operational flexibility.
The ability to operate rooms in both positive and negative pressure modes enables the department to adapt quickly to different clinical requirements, without the need for structural alterations.
Full integration of systems.
The solution eliminates technological silos and creates a coherent system in which every component communicates.
Efficiency in management and maintenance.
Thanks to remote control, response times are drastically reduced and maintenance becomes more predictive and less intrusive.
Ease of use.
WebGarage’s intuitive interface makes it easy for even non-specialist staff to manage the system.
